Heinrich visits Slate Street Café, restaurant saved by PPP

On Tuesday, April 6, 2021, Senator Heinrich visited with Myra Ghattas, owner of Slate Street Café and 66 Acres in Albuquerque. Myra has participated in both rounds of the PPP program and feels like the program has saved her business. Senator Heinrich helped secure a $28.6 billion Restaurant Revitalization Fund in the American Rescue Plan to help local restaurants keep their doors open and keep their workers employed.
